Experimental investigation of complex ion formation in solution of transformer oil with iodine - Trang 21-24
A.I. Zhakin
The processes of ion-complex formation (ionic pairs, triplets, dipole-dipole and ion-dipole clusters) and associated conductivity in liquid dielectrics are considered. Experimental method and results on ionization process in solution of transformer ion with iodine are discussed.

Measurement equipment for investigation of the influence of viscosity of dielectric working fluids on spark erosion - Trang 301-304
H.-P. Schulze, G. Wollenberg, M. Lauter, M. Storr, W. Rehbein
In the paper functional goals of the measurement equipment for the investigation of electrical discharges in dielectric working fluids are discussed. Electrical discharges take place at electrode distances smaller than 200 /spl mu/m. As an example the influence of the viscosity on the ignition behaviour and on typical phases of the spark erosion are analyzed.

Electrical properties of fluorinated gel electrolytes using conducting solution and its application to secondary battery - Trang 365-368
J. Kyokane, T. Minami, K. Morishima, H. Sawada
The lithium ionic electrolytes of fluorinated gel materials have been found to show high ionic conductivity. We proposed the application to a lithium ion secondary battery using this gel electrolyte. Study of orientation of liquid crystal molecules at interface by shear horizontal wave - Trang 386-389
K. Yoshino, M. Inoue, H. Moritake, K. Toda
The director-orientation of a liquid crystal near an interface between a glass plate and a liquid-crystal layer is studied under propagation of a shear horizontal (SH) acoustic wave. An acoustic phase-delay of a SH wave device with various liquid-crystal director orientations, which is affected by the liquid-crystal director orientation, is measured. Cathode sheath formation of corona discharge in liquid argon - Trang 131-134
N. Bonifaci, A. Denat, V.M. Atrazhev, V.V. Atrazhev, I.V. Kochetov, A.P. Napartovich
A one-dimensional longitudinal model including the cathode sheath, the drift region and the external circuit has been used for conditions close to experiments of a corona discharge in liquid Ar. Factors contributing to streamer morphology - Trang 155-158
R.E. Hebner
Recent work shows that the range of morphology of anode streamers in liquid dielectric breakdown is predicted when it is represented as stochastic growth of a branching fractal tree. This model may be analogous to the critical volume model of breakdown used in gases. An investigation of discharges in oil insulation using UHF PD detection - Trang 341-344
G.P. Cleary, M.D. Judd
In this paper, partial discharge (PD) is generated using a range of electrode configurations in an oil insulated system. High voltage AC at 50 Hz is applied to each test configuration and the PD activity is recorded using an ultra high frequency (UHF) monitoring system. Time dependence of dielectric properties of human body phantoms - Trang 33-36
K. Fukunaga, S. Watanabe, K. Wake, Y. Yamanaka
Standard methods for measurement of the specific absorption rate (SAR) including recipes of tissue-equivalent dielectric liquid have been discussed by international standard organisations in order to evaluate mobile telecommunication equipment. Effect of co-field flow velocity, temperature and dissolved gases on the direct breakdown voltage of transformer oil using point-to-plane electrodes - Trang 95-98
I.Y. Megahed, M.A. Abdallah, A.A. Zaky
This paper presents results on the effect of enforced co-field oil flow velocity and of temperature on the breakdown voltage of transformer oil using point-to-plane electrodes. Determination of water content in transformer insulation - Trang 337-340
A. Shkolnik
This paper describes the possibility of estimation of water content in oil impregnated cellulose insulation in accordance with results of measured relative humidity of transformer's oil. This method is usable for energizing transformers.
